External Attention Focus Enhances Standing Long Jump Performance by Modulating Muscle Dynamics Compared With Internal
Xinxin Liu1, Jian Chen1,2, Zhengye Pan3
1School of Health Science, Wuhan Sports University, Wuhan, HUB, China.
External focus (EF) training enhances standing long jump performance by improving muscle force production and efficiency. This strategy optimizes mechanics, leading to greater jump distances.
Area of Science:
- Biomechanics
- Sports Science
- Motor Control
Background:
- Attentional focus strategies are crucial in sports training.
- External focus (EF) improves standing long jump (SLJ) performance.
- Muscular dynamics underlying EF benefits in SLJ are not well understood.
Purpose of the Study:
- To investigate the effects of EF on muscular dynamics during the SLJ.
- To compare EF with internal focus (IF) and control conditions.
Main Methods:
- 12 healthy males performed SLJ under EF, IF, and control conditions using a Latin square design.
- Kinematic and dynamic data were recorded during the take-off phase.
- Inverse dynamics analysis was used to calculate joint and muscle forces.
Main Results:
- EF resulted in longer jump distances, lower projection angles, and higher peak horizontal velocities and impulses compared to IF and control.
- EF increased center of mass displacement during eccentric muscle action and decreased it during concentric action.
- Peak muscle force and rate of force development in the vastus lateralis, vastus medialis, vastus intermedius, and gluteus maximus were higher under EF.
Conclusions:
- EF strategy enhances SLJ mechanics by improving eccentric muscle contraction efficiency.
- This leads to increased stored elastic potential energy, boosting concentric force production.
- The findings suggest EF optimizes muscle function for greater jump performance.
